A Web Developer Portfolio is a curated collection of projects and skills designed to demonstrate a developer’s capabilities and attract clients or employers.
Why A Web Developer Portfolio Matters
A web developer portfolio acts as a digital resume, but far more dynamic and impactful. It offers tangible proof of your skills, creativity, and problem-solving abilities. Unlike a traditional CV that lists experience in dry text, a portfolio visually showcases your work through live projects, code snippets, designs, and case studies. This immersive experience helps potential employers or clients quickly assess your fit for their needs.
In the competitive world of web development, having an impressive portfolio is often the deciding factor between landing an interview or being overlooked. It reflects not only technical proficiency but also your ability to communicate ideas clearly and professionally. Whether you specialize in front-end design, back-end development, or full-stack solutions, the portfolio provides a platform to highlight your unique strengths.
Moreover, portfolios evolve with your career. They chronicle your growth and adaptability by including new technologies and trends you’ve mastered over time. In essence, it’s a living document that tells your professional story in a compelling way.
Essential Components of A Web Developer Portfolio
Crafting an effective web developer portfolio involves more than throwing together random projects. Each element must serve a purpose in illustrating your expertise and personality.
1. Introduction & Personal Branding
Start with a clear introduction that summarizes who you are as a developer. This includes your name, specialization (e.g., React developer, WordPress expert), and what drives you professionally. Personal branding elements such as logos, consistent color schemes, and typography help create a memorable impression.
The heart of any portfolio is the project showcase section. Select 4-6 quality projects that demonstrate diverse skills—responsive design, API integration, database management, or e-commerce functionality. Each project should have:
- Project Title: Clear and descriptive.
- Project Description: Concise explanation of objectives and challenges.
- Your Role: Specific contributions made.
- Technologies Used: Languages, frameworks, tools involved.
- Links: Live demo URL and GitHub repository if available.
List all relevant programming languages, frameworks, libraries, CMS platforms, version control systems (like Git), and other tools you’re proficient in. This section should be easy to scan so recruiters can instantly spot key qualifications.
4. Contact Information & Social Links
Make it effortless for visitors to reach out by including email addresses or contact forms prominently on the site. Adding links to LinkedIn profiles or Twitter accounts can also boost credibility.
5. Testimonials & Certifications (Optional)
If possible, include client testimonials or endorsements from colleagues to add social proof of your reliability and professionalism. Certifications from recognized platforms like freeCodeCamp or Coursera reinforce your expertise.
The Technical Backbone Behind A Web Developer Portfolio
Building a portfolio requires choosing the right tech stack that aligns with your skills while ensuring smooth user experience.
Static vs Dynamic Portfolios
Static portfolios are simple HTML/CSS/JS websites hosted on platforms like GitHub Pages or Netlify. They load fast but lack interactivity beyond basic animations.
Dynamic portfolios use backend technologies such as Node.js or PHP combined with databases to deliver personalized content or blogs integrated into the site. These require more maintenance but offer richer functionality.
Popular Frameworks & Tools for Portfolios
Many developers prefer frameworks like React.js or Vue.js for building interactive interfaces quickly while maintaining modular codebases.
Static site generators such as Gatsby or Hugo provide speed advantages by pre-rendering pages during build time.
Content management systems like WordPress allow easier content updates without coding but may introduce overhead if not optimized properly.
Version control through Git ensures changes are tracked systematically — crucial when iterating on portfolio designs over time.
The Role of Design in A Web Developer Portfolio
Design isn’t just about aesthetics; it influences usability and perception heavily.
User Experience (UX) Principles
Navigation should be intuitive with clear menus guiding visitors through sections effortlessly. Responsive design guarantees accessibility across devices from desktops to smartphones without breaking layouts.
Whitespace balances content density so pages don’t overwhelm viewers visually while emphasizing important sections naturally.
Visual Hierarchy & Typography
Use headings strategically to separate topics clearly; employ font sizes and weights to guide attention flow logically down the page.
Color palettes should complement personal branding without clashing—neutral backgrounds with vibrant accents often strike the right tone between professional yet modern vibes.
Common Mistakes to Avoid in A Web Developer Portfolio
- Lack of Focus: Including too many unrelated projects dilutes impact; quality trumps quantity.
- Poor Navigation: Visitors shouldn’t hunt for information—streamlined menus matter.
- No Context: Projects without explanations leave viewers guessing about challenges tackled.
- Ignoring Mobile Users: Overlooking mobile responsiveness alienates large audience segments.
- No Contact Info: If interested parties can’t reach you easily, opportunities slip away.
Avoid these pitfalls by regularly reviewing user feedback and analytics data if available.
A Web Developer Portfolio: Comparison of Popular Hosting Options
| Hosting Platform | Main Features | Best For |
|---|---|---|
| GitHub Pages | Free hosting for static sites; integrates with Git; custom domains supported. | Budding developers showcasing static portfolios; open-source projects. |
| Netlify | Continuous deployment; serverless functions; global CDN; form handling. | Dynamically generated sites using JAMstack; interactive portfolios. |
| AWS Amplify | Simplified backend integration; supports React/Vue/Angular frameworks; scalable hosting. | Larger projects needing backend services alongside frontend hosting. |
Choosing the right platform depends on technical needs and budget constraints but starting simple is usually best for newcomers.
Tips for Keeping Your Web Developer Portfolio Updated & Relevant
The tech world moves fast—your portfolio must keep pace:
- Add new projects regularly: Reflect current skills by showcasing recent work involving trending technologies like Next.js or Tailwind CSS.
- Edit outdated content: Remove obsolete tools or deprecated practices that could undermine credibility.
- User feedback incorporation: Ask peers for usability critiques to refine UX continuously.
- Create blog posts or tutorials: Demonstrate thought leadership beyond code snippets by sharing knowledge publicly.
- Migrate tech stack when necessary: If better frameworks emerge aligning with industry standards, don’t hesitate to rebuild sections accordingly.
This ongoing maintenance signals professionalism and passion for growth—qualities highly prized in developers.
The Impact of A Well-Crafted Web Developer Portfolio on Career Growth
A well-built portfolio opens doors beyond job applications:
- Differentiation from competition: Showcasing unique problem-solving approaches sets you apart amidst hundreds of candidates vying for similar roles.
- Easier networking opportunities: Sharing portfolio links during meetups or online communities sparks meaningful conversations about specific projects rather than vague descriptions.
- Smoother freelance acquisition: Potential clients gain confidence seeing completed work before committing financially—reducing friction significantly.
- Lifelong learning documentation:You track progress transparently which encourages self-reflection leading to continuous improvement cycles over years rather than stagnation.
- Bigger salary negotiations leverage:Your proven track record justifies higher compensation requests backed by concrete evidence instead of mere claims on resumes alone.
These benefits emphasize why investing effort upfront into creating A Web Developer Portfolio pays dividends throughout one’s career trajectory.
Key Takeaways: A Web Developer Portfolio
➤ Showcase diverse projects to highlight your skills.
➤ Keep design clean for easy navigation.
➤ Include contact info for potential employers.
➤ Optimize loading speed for better user experience.
➤ Update regularly to reflect your latest work.
Frequently Asked Questions
What is a Web Developer Portfolio?
A Web Developer Portfolio is a curated collection of projects and skills that showcase a developer’s abilities. It serves as a dynamic digital resume, highlighting real work through live projects, code samples, and case studies to attract potential employers or clients.
Why does a Web Developer Portfolio matter?
A Web Developer Portfolio matters because it provides tangible proof of your skills and creativity. Unlike a traditional CV, it visually demonstrates your technical proficiency and problem-solving capabilities, making it easier for employers to assess your fit for their needs.
What should I include in my Web Developer Portfolio?
Your Web Developer Portfolio should include an introduction, personal branding elements, and a showcase of 4-6 quality projects. Each project needs a clear title, description, your role, technologies used, and links to live demos or repositories to effectively illustrate your expertise.
How often should I update my Web Developer Portfolio?
A Web Developer Portfolio should be regularly updated to reflect new skills, technologies, and projects. As your career evolves, adding recent work keeps the portfolio relevant and demonstrates your ongoing growth and adaptability in the fast-changing web development field.
Can a Web Developer Portfolio help me get hired?
Yes, a well-crafted Web Developer Portfolio can significantly improve your chances of getting hired. It acts as a compelling story of your professional journey, showcasing not only technical skills but also your ability to communicate ideas clearly and professionally to potential employers.